react tsx语法入门#phyton编程入门 #前端 #程序代码 #干货分享 #程序猿日常 - 小满zs于20240906发布在抖音,已经收获了14.0万个喜欢,来抖音,记录美好生活!
想要开始react+tsx开发,可以根据实例来做 安装: 基于react-app脚手架使用: yarn create react-app myapp --template typescript 尝试新建一个子组件 新建Hello.tsx /* * @Descripttion: * @version: ... 数据类型 函数式 typescript javascript react的tsx有组织架构类似的组件吗 ts写react 创建项目实际开发过...
tsx如何使用泛型 正常写泛型语法会跟tsx语法冲突,他会把泛型理解成是一个元素,解决方案后面加一个,即可 function App() { const value: string = '小满' const clickTap = <T,>(params: T) => console.log(params) return ( <> clickTap(value)}>{value} </> ) } 1. 2. 3. 4. 5. 6. 7....
tsx 导入js文件的时候js,编译阶段没有报错,同样是直接的import进去的 2、第二个他们要解决的问题就是tsx转换为js,进行单元测试吧、他们是如何转换的呢?
首先,TSX允许我们在React组件中使用JSX语法,JSX是一种类似HTML的语法,它允许我们在JavaScript代码中编写类似HTML标记的内容。在TSX中,我们可以直接在React组件中编写JSX,这使得我们能够更加直观地描述组件的UI结构。 其次,TSX还提供了对组件属性和状态的静态类型检查。通过使用TypeScript的类型系统,我们可以在编译时就发现...
TSX(TypeScript JSX)是TypeScript对JSX的扩展,它允许开发者在React组件中使用TypeScript。TSX结合了TypeScript的类型检查和JSX的声明式UI构建能力,为开发大型React应用提供了强大的支持。 2. TSX与JSX的区别 类型检查:JSX是JavaScript的语法扩展,用于描述React组件的结构。而TSX在JSX的基础上添加了类型检查,使得开发者在...
在React中,显示和隐藏.tsx文件可以通过CSS样式或React组件的条件渲染来实现。 使用CSS样式:通过给.tsx文件的外层元素添加display属性来控制显示和隐藏。例如,给.tsx文件的外层元素添加一个名为"hidden"的CSS类: 代码语言:txt 复制 .hidden { display: none; }...
是指在使用React框架中,编写的tsx组件函数没有正确接收到传入的值。 在React中,组件函数可以通过props参数接收传入的值。tsx函数组件可以定义props的类型,以确保接收到的值符合预期。例如,可以使用接口定义props的类型: 代码语言:txt 复制 interface MyComponentProps { value: string; } const MyComponent: React.FC...
前言 在上一章:React 简单教程-1-组件 我们知道了 React 的组件是什么,长什么样,用 js 和 HTML 小小体验了一下组件。在这一章,我们将使用 typescript(简称 ts) 来代替 js,这种语法的文件名后缀是 tsx。 我强烈建议使用 ts 来开发 React,要说 ts
第二个问题是,tsx编写的组件,是如何支持导入test.js中进行单元测试的? tsx 导入js文件的时候js,编译阶段没有报错,同样是直接的import进去的 //index.test.js import React from 'react'; import TestUtils from 'react-dom/test-utils'; import { Col, Row } from '..'; //看过antd源码的会知道,这两...